ftp (로긴+디렉토리 지정)를 편하게 쓰기 위한 스크립트?
글쓴이: foruses / 작성시간: 화, 2008/04/22 - 3:36오전
$ftp
>o
servername
username
passwd
ftp>cd /scratch/work1
ftp>prompt
ftp>mget file1 file2
ftp>quit
위 과정을 일일이 타이핑 하지 않고, 스크립트 또는 ftp 옵션을 써서 실행하는 방법이 있을까요?
패스워드 입력은 보안상 안하고요.
sftp 의 경우,
$sftp user@server:/scratch/work1
로, 일단 디렉토리까지 찾아들어가는 건 쉬웠는데요.
감사합니다.
Forums:
일단은, man
일단은,
다음을 ftp.scr로 저장.
마지막으로,
-----
오늘 나의 취미는 끝없는, 끝없는 인내다. 1973 法頂
-----
오늘 나의 취미는 끝없는, 끝없는 인내다. 1973 法頂
$ftp>oservernameusernamepassw
보통 이렇게들 쓰시는듯.....bash,tcsh 에서..
lftp
lftp 사용 가능하시면(우분투에는 기본적으로 깔려있더군요) lftp로 하는 방법도 있습니다.
$ lftp servername -u username,passwd -e "cd /scratch/work1; mget file1 file2; quit"
또는
$ lftp -f 스크립트파일
',passwd' 부분은 생략 가능하며, sftp도 접속할 수 있습니다.
$ lftp sftp://servername
그리고 lftp는 기본적으로 덮어쓰기를 합니다.
lftp 감사합니다..
다른 ftp도 좋지만, lftp는 제가 원하는 타입의 ftp입니다.
스크립트 지원도 만족할 만하고요.
정말 감사합니다.
man ncftp -- C FAQ:
man ncftp
--
C FAQ: http://www.eskimo.com/~scs/C-faq/top.html
Korean Ver: http://www.cinsk.org/cfaqs/
C FAQ: http://www.eskimo.com/~scs/C-faq/top.html
Korean Ver: http://cinsk.github.io/cfaqs/
댓글 달기